How to Choose an Accident Injury Attorney

If you choose to hire an attorney for personal injury and they start a lawsuit in order to hold negligent companies and individuals liable for the harm they cause. They will also gather evidence and prepare for trial if needed.

They will look over your accumulated medical bills, review your medical reports that provide a narrative to help you be aware of your injuries and request a new one if needed, and talk with insurance companies about negotiating an acceptable settlement offer.

Experience

An experienced attorney will help you create a strong case that covers your losses, regardless of how severe your injuries are. This may include medical bills as well as lost wages as well as property damage and suffering and pain. An attorney for injuries from accidents will also calculate the cost of any other non-economic damages, like emotional distress and loss of quality of life.

A lawyer for car accidents will assist you in navigating the complex legal system. They will collect evidence to prove that the at-fault party's responsibility, record your injuries and treatments and negotiate with insurance companies. They may also file a suit if necessary to obtain the maximum amount of compensation.

When you are choosing a car crash attorney, it is important to research their credentials and experience. You may also look up client reviews and ask family and friends to recommend lawyers. In addition, you should examine the lawyer's availability and responsiveness as well as their fee structure. Some lawyers are on a contingency basis while others charge hourly rates.

A reputable accident lawyer will have a track record of representing clients in court. In the majority of cases, injuries are settled without ever going to trial, but you want an attorney who is not unwilling to fight for what you're entitled to in the courtroom in the event of a need.

It is important to know how long you have to wait before you are able to start a lawsuit. This is known as the statute of limitations, and it varies by state. An experienced lawyer will explain this law in depth and inform you of any circumstance that could cause a delay or toll the statute of limitations.

While the sum of money you spend will never cover the physical pain and financial burden, it can help ease the burden of rising costs and restore some peace and order to your life. An experienced accident attorney will evaluate your damages and seek the maximum amount of compensation. They will take into consideration your future and present medical costs, lost income and the cost to repair or replace your vehicle. They will also consider the effect of your injuries on your daily life and activities as well as the pain and suffering you endure.

Fees

The fees charged by accident injury attorneys vary depending on the type and extent of the case. An accident injury lawyers lawyer may charge a flat fee or a percentage based on the amount of compensation they pay to their client. The percentage and fee structure of an accident lawyer could be negotiated before hiring. This way the client can be sure that they are getting an honest price.

A seasoned attorney in car accidents will thoroughly investigate your claim and provide you with a detailed breakdown of the damages. This will help you determine the amount your maximum payout should be. They can also negotiate with the insurer and ensure that your claim is submitted correctly. If they're not, you'll be at a disadvantage in receiving full and timely reimbursement for your losses.

You can also seek help from a lawyer for car accidents to navigate the complicated legal procedure. They are skilled negotiators and can match the skills insurance adjusters in order to get you a fair settlement. Additionally, they can help with obtaining vital documentation, including medical records and accident reports. They can also offer assistance on how to file an action against the at-fault driver or other party accountable for your injuries.

Some lawyers only receive compensation if they are able to get compensation from clients. This arrangement helps clients avoid having to pay upfront costs for legal services. However, this type of arrangement might not be suitable for all types of cases. If your case requires extensive litigation and is complicated it may be necessary to engage an attorney on an the hourly basis.

In these situations the attorney's fee will be subtracted from any compensation you receive. In most cases, the fee is 33.3% of the total amount after the costs are subtracted from it. These are the expenses incurred by your lawyer to prepare and present your claim to an insurance company, or to bring a lawsuit. These costs include filing fees, court charges as well as the cost of bringing in experts to defend your claim.
